What you need to know
Flour + Water opened in May 2009 at 20th and Harrison in the Mission and has been a hard reservation in San Francisco since. The pasta program is the focus, made fresh daily and changing with the season. Co-chefs Thomas McNaughton and Ryan Pollnow run the kitchen.
The Pasta
Made fresh each day; the menu shifts with the season. Pappardelle with pork sugo, tajarin with truffles when they’re in, agnolotti with seasonal fillings, spaghetti with sea urchin. The kitchen also offers a 10-course pasta tasting menu, which is the longer-form version of the menu.
Beyond Pasta
Wood-fired pizzas with thin, blistered crust. Antipasti using California produce. House-made salumi. The wine list leans Italian and California.
The Space
Exposed brick, an open kitchen, around 50 seats.
